Baby Monitor Buying Guide: Audio, Video, and Smart Options

Which type of monitor is right for your family?

Baby monitors range from $30 to $400. Here's what's worth it.

Audio Only ($30-60)

Simple, reliable, long battery life. Best for: minimalists, small homes, backup monitor.

Video (Non-WiFi) ($100-200)

Dedicated screen, no hacking concerns, no subscription fees. Top pick: Eufy SpaceView.

Smart/WiFi ($150-400)

Phone viewing, multiple cameras, alerts. Beware subscription fees. Top picks: Nanit, Owlet Cam.

Wearable ($200-400)

Tracks breathing/heart rate. Owlet Smart Sock is popular but controversial (can cause anxiety).

Our take: A good video monitor without WiFi is the sweet spot for most families.
